- 博客(17)
- 资源 (5)
- 收藏
- 关注
原创 关于各种头文件无法加载问题:无法加载源文件:stdio.h windows.h 等等
网上搜索被人给了一堆答案,各种花里胡哨的方法,反正我是没试成功。经同学提点,其实原因很简单,就是SDK版本不对,大多数出现在直接在自己的电脑上运行别人的程序时出现。解决方法:项目->属性->window SDK 版本 换一个,一般除了你当前使用的版本,都会给你提供另一个选项,那就是适合的版本。OK,解决!!...
2020-08-24 17:12:46
1046
1
原创 VS调试时如何跳出for循环?
例如这个程序,如果我单步调试时进入了第116行的for循环那么不论我们是(逐语句)F10还是(逐过程)F11还是(跳出)shift+F11,都无法做到让for循环一次性执行完。解决办法:在for循环外设置断点,如:行125--------->F8跳到下一个断点(即行125),因VS版本而异,有些版本做不到(我的VS2017就不行).更简单的方法:在循环外设置一个断点,ctrl+F10(执行到当前语句),就可以跳到当前设置的断点位置。...
2020-07-10 16:13:52
8131
2
原创 无法打开好多源文件,体现为:include下面有波浪线
大概样子如图,报错编号为E1696。解决方法:1.解决资源管理器中,右键项目名-----属性-----常规-----把windows SDK版本调为10.XXXX,平台工具集改为VS2017(自己的版本,我用的是VS2017)2.再选到VC++目录------包含目录里添加:C:\Program Files (x86)\Windows Kits\10\Include\10.0.17763.0(看自己的版本)\ucrt 目录解决!亲测可用...
2020-07-08 14:38:15
3569
1
原创 关于VS调试时慢,一直显示正在从以下位置加载xxxxxxx.dll的符号:Microsoft符号服务器,尝试取消将禁用后续符号加载。
接上一篇博客,在昨天的调试中,一直很慢,我一直不知道怎么解决。今天试了一下,其实这就是因为我们按照网上所说的的方法,让调试器在调试过程中在Microsoft符号服务器上加载各种符号导致的。其实在调试过程中这些符号不需要加载。所以我们只需要:打开vs的【工具】-【选项】-【调试】-【符号】1、先取消勾选“Microsoft符号服务器”2、清空符号缓存3、确定4、然后重启一下VS2017再打开工程调试就可以了,快如闪电。这样调试估计又会有人出现调试调试着弹出无法加载XXXXX.pdb文件而..
2020-07-08 10:48:42
6708
3
原创 关于无法加载XXXXXX.PDB的问题解决方法
大致的警告类似于这个图,就是程序在编译时没加载到各种pdb文件。其实,这个并不影响我们编译程序,直接ctrl+F5程序依然可以正常编译,麻烦就在于调试时会出现异常中断,或者无休止的让我们加载.DLL文件。优快云上解决这个问题的方法有很多,大同小异,无外乎这样两步:1.【工具】->【选项】->【调试】->【常规]】勾选“启用源服务器支持”2.【工具】->【选项】->【调试】->【符号】,勾选“Microsoft符号服务器说实话这个方法我试了,然而没..
2020-07-07 16:51:41
8497
2
原创 QT5串口通信
Qt串口通信1.新建工程,基类选择QwidgetNew Project-----Application-----Qt Widget Application-----choose------名称栏填写QtComm(路径不要有中文)--------下一步------下一步-----基类下拉框选择Qwid...
2019-01-19 09:33:38
1216
1
原创 VS2013工控机间通信
VS2013工控机间通信2018.10.17一、页面布局及加入控件1, 安装好vs2013如图2, 新建一个基于VC++的MFC项目MSCOMM注意:点击确定,然后下一步,这时候要将应用程序类型改成基于对话框。接着下一步到最后一个对话框是将生成的类改成CCommDlg,然后完成4, 将新生成的项目的对话框默认dialog edit删去,如图5,点开右边工具箱...
2018-11-22 19:30:51
612
转载 H∞控制
Robust Control System:反馈控制具有承受某一类不确定影响的能力,即在这一类不确定条件下具有保持(系统)稳定性、动态特性(灵敏度)和稳态特性(渐进调节)的能力。非结构不确定性(Unstructured Uncertainty),如外界扰动带来的影响——H∞控制(本文的内容)结构不确定性(Structured Uncertainty)如系统参数的不确定性变化——μ分析与μ综...
2018-11-22 19:21:51
20674
原创 Qt中构建目录与源文件必须为同级目录的解决办法
这个问题一般出现在将程序从一台电脑转移到另一电脑, 路径发生变化,重新构建运行时会出现“QT 构建目录必须和源目录为同级目录”提示,解决办法:1.路径不能出现中文2.点击 project-> 然后 看看Buit directory ,看看这里是不是文字变成了红色, 如果是红色的路径,说明你的路径是错误的, 改一个你自己的路径即可。 ...
2018-10-30 11:10:13
5057
原创 VC学习笔记-MFC的窗口读取与写入
读取:从窗口的编辑框读取字符串,并将其存在str中。方法1、CString str;GetDlgItem(IDC_TEXT)->GetWindowText(str);//IDC_TEXT为要读取的文本框的ID解释说明:GetDlgItem():返回一个指向指定控件或子窗口的指针 GetWindowText():该函数将指定窗口的标题条文本(如果存在)拷贝到一个缓...
2018-06-24 15:13:27
447
原创 一次就好,陪你到天荒地老。vs2013配置opencv2.4.13
vs2013+opencv2.3.14+windows7系统= vision system下载好后,双击进行安装(PS:其实它的安装过程是个解压的过程)。要记住好安装的路径,后边需要。【建议】在英文路径下,不用有中文和空格。============================分割线==============2-电脑系统环境配置在系统属性里Path变量,添加OpenCV的bin路径,见下图:以...
2018-06-16 16:04:37
292
原创 学习笔记 :VC--GPS数据读取和处理中一些函数的使用
分割字符串的AfxExtractSubString函数:例如这样一组GPS接收到的数据:m_gps=$GPRMC,024813.640,A,3158.4608,N,11848.3737,E,10.05,324.27,150706,,,A*50 AfxExtractSubString(state,m_gps,2,',');MFC分割 字符串的函数,state分割后的字符串,m_gps待分割的字符串,...
2018-06-15 22:20:12
414
翻译 教你读懂GPS数据
GPS数据解析 NMEA-0183协议是为了在不同的GPS(全球定位系统)导航设备中建立统一的BTCM(海事无线电技术委员会)标准,由美国国家海洋电子协会(NMEA-The National Marine Electronics Associa-tion)制定的一套通讯协议。GPS接收机根据NMEA-0183协议的标准规范,将位置、速度等信息通过串口传送到设备。 NMEA-01...
2018-06-15 15:37:39
11860
转载 VC MFC字符格式转换
1、VARIANT转COleSafeArray、 COleSafeArray转BYTE型数组在串口通信的OnCommMscomm()事件中会涉及到这两种类型转换,比如:VARIANT variant_inp;COleSafeArray safearray_inp;LONG len;BYTE rxdata[2048];if(m_cmsSerial.get_CommEvent()==2) //事件...
2018-06-15 14:10:34
1011
转载 Matlab rand()函数用法
rand函数产生由在(0, 1)之间均匀分布的随机数组成的数组。本人遇到的是matlab中的rand(a,b)语句,为了清楚这个语句的用法,这里我们随便输入a,b,例如1和4回车之后结果为如图所示4个数字,可以看到这4个数均为1以内,且为1行4列同样地,若我们输入rand(2,4),则会得到一个2行4列的在1以内的随机矩阵ans = 0.2769 0.0971 0.6948 ...
2018-05-11 10:30:06
348642
10
原创 学习笔记--Pygame的安装
安装pygame1、将扩展名为.whl的文件复制到你的项目文件夹里,打开文件夹--shift+右键--在此处打开命令窗口--输入python -m pip install --user pygame-1.9.3-cp36-cp36m-win32.whl标红的部分为文件名。注意空格。2、验证是否安装成功:打开python的终端窗口--输入import pygame--结果如下说明成功了如果没成功,在...
2018-05-02 15:08:07
310
原创 学习笔记--Python 从安装到入门
安装python和pip 第一步、第二步点击Customize installation: 第三步验证自己安装好了么:安装完成后打开cmd,用以下命令查看版本信息,若返回版本号且无报错则安装成功。1、python --version 用来查看python的版本信息2、pip --version 查看pip信息结果: 安装Geany双击Geany,一路next,即可安装成功关于Geany...
2018-04-27 10:50:30
241
第一本无人驾驶书-刘少山
2018-06-15
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人